Chrome wire shelving is a metal storage system made from steel wire racks coated with a chrome finish to improve durability and corrosion resistance. It is commonly used in restaurant kitchens, bakeries, grocery stores, and foodservice storage rooms for organizing dry goods, kitchen equipment, and supplies. Most commercial units support 600–800 pounds per shelf when weight is evenly distributed. The open-wire design improves air circulation, which helps maintain proper food storage conditions.
Many chrome wire shelving units are NSF certified, meaning they meet sanitation standards required for food contact environments and restaurant kitchens. NSF International evaluates shelving materials to ensure they are corrosion resistant, easy to clean, and suitable for commercial equipment storage. NSF-certified shelving is commonly used in dry storage rooms, bakeries, and grocery stores. However, chrome finishes are generally recommended for dry environments rather than high-moisture areas.
Chrome wire shelving is best used in dry storage areas within restaurants, cafés, bakeries, and grocery stores. These shelves are commonly installed in pantry rooms, supply storage areas, and equipment storage spaces where humidity levels remain low. Because chrome finishes offer moderate corrosion resistance, they are not typically recommended for walk-in refrigerators, freezers, or dishwashing areas. In those environments, epoxy-coated or stainless steel shelving is usually preferred.
Chrome wire shelving typically lasts 7–15 years in commercial environments when used in dry storage conditions. The lifespan depends on factors such as humidity levels, cleaning frequency, and load weight. In restaurant kitchens and grocery storage rooms, chrome-plated steel resists corrosion when properly maintained. However, exposure to moisture, salt, or cleaning chemicals can shorten its lifespan, which is why epoxy-coated shelving is often recommended for refrigerated environments.
Chrome wire shelving for commercial foodservice typically comes in widths ranging from 24 to 72 inches and depths from 14 to 24 inches. Standard shelving units often stand between 54 and 86 inches tall depending on the number of shelves installed. These size options allow restaurant kitchens, bakeries, and grocery stores to configure storage systems that fit available space while maintaining organized inventory management.
Chrome wire shelving is designed to support heavy loads, typically ranging from 600 to 800 pounds per shelf depending on shelf size and manufacturer specifications. In commercial restaurant kitchens and storage areas, this capacity allows operators to store bulk ingredients, small appliances, and kitchen equipment safely. Weight ratings are usually tested under evenly distributed conditions. NSF-certified shelving is commonly used in foodservice environments to ensure the materials meet sanitation and structural standards.
Chrome wire shelving provides better airflow, visibility, and sanitation compared to solid shelving surfaces. The open-wire structure allows air to circulate around stored items, helping maintain stable temperatures in dry storage areas and reducing dust accumulation. In restaurant kitchens, this design also improves visibility and inventory organization. Many commercial operators prefer wire shelving because it is lightweight, adjustable in 1-inch increments, and easier to clean than solid metal shelves.
Chrome wire shelving improves food safety by promoting airflow and reducing the buildup of moisture and dust around stored items. In commercial restaurant kitchens, this open design helps maintain consistent storage conditions and makes it easier to monitor inventory. Shelves are typically adjustable in 1-inch increments, allowing operators to organize ingredients, containers, and equipment efficiently. NSF-certified shelving also supports compliance with food safety guidelines followed by FDA-regulated foodservice operations.
Chrome wire shelving units are assembled using vertical posts, adjustable shelf clips, and wire shelves that lock into place at set height intervals. Most commercial shelving systems allow height adjustments in 1-inch increments, enabling flexible storage configurations. Assembly usually requires no specialized tools and can be completed in 15–30 minutes. This modular design allows restaurant kitchens and foodservice operators to expand or reconfigure shelving layouts as storage needs change.
Chrome wire shelving uses a polished chrome plating designed for dry storage environments, while epoxy-coated shelving features a protective polymer coating designed for moisture resistance. In restaurant kitchens, chrome shelving is typically used in pantry areas and dry ingredient storage rooms. Epoxy-coated shelving is commonly installed in walk-in refrigerators and freezers because it can withstand temperatures as low as -20°F and high humidity without corrosion.
